Deck the Halls Week 1

Questions

  • Pray and invite God into this time with Him.

  • Do you set up a Christmas tree in your house? Why do you do that? 

  • Read Genesis 2:16-17

  • Before fancy Christmas ornaments became a thing, we used to hang apples on Christmas trees. The apples remind us of our sin–have you ever thought about the symbolism behind the things we do for Christmas? 

  • If someone were to ask you if you were a ‘good person’, what would you say and why do you say that? 

  • Read Romans 3:10-12, 23 & 6:23

  • We actually can’t be good enough, but Jesus is. How does that encourage you in your walk with Him? 

  • Talk about the evergreen (Christmas) tree & how it’s similar to Jesus. 

  • Read Matthew 1:21

  • Jesus came to bring life! Take some time to think about all the ways He has brought life into your life and thank Him for it.


Spiritual Practice
Prayer: Spend time in prayer with God. Thank Jesus for being able to fulfill the “good enough” standard that God requires in our place. Thank Him for bringing life. Ask God to help you remember all the ways He has brought life into your life.
